How We Fix Water Damage from Window Leaks in Riverdale, UT
Fixing water damage from window leaks isn’t just about drying the area; it’s about using the right equipment and following a proven process to prevent future problems. Our team uses thermal imaging cameras to find hidden moisture, specialized drying equipment to speed up the drying process, and containment procedures to prevent further damage.
Step 1: Assess the Damage
Within 60 minutes, our technicians will assess the damage, identify the source of the leak, and develop a customized plan to fix it. They’ll use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ture and identify the affected areas.
Step 2: Contain the Water
Our team will set up containment equipment to prevent further water from entering the affected area. This includes sealing off the room, removing any wet materials, and installing a temporary ceiling to prevent future water damage.
Step 3: Extract Water and Dry the Area
We’ll use specialized equipment to extract as much water as possible from the affected area. Our technicians will then use high-velocity fans and dehumidifiers to speed up the drying process, ensuring the area is completely dry within 3-5 days.
Step 4: Clean and Disinfect
After the area is dry, our team will clean and disinfect the space, removing any remaining moisture and preventing mold growth. This ensures your home is safe and healthy for you and your family.

Warning Signs You Need Window Leak Water Removal in Riverdale, UT
Ignoring these warning signs can lead to bigger problems down the road, including mold growth, structural damage, and costly repairs. If you notice any of these signs, contact us immediately to prevent further damage.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
A persistent musty smell in your home can show hidden moisture and potential mold growth. Our team can identify the source of the smell and fix it before it becomes a bigger issue.
Water Stains on Walls and Ceilings
Water stains on walls and ceilings can show a more serious issue, such as a leaky roof or pipe. Our team can identify the source of the stain and fix it before it leads to further damage.
Spongy or Soft Flooring
If your flooring feels spongy or soft, it may show hidden moisture and potential structural damage. Our team can identify the source of the issue and fix it before it becomes a bigger problem.
Peeling Paint and Wallpaper
Peeling paint and wallpaper can show hidden moisture and potential mold growth. Our team can identify the source of the issue and fix it before it leads to further damage.
Discolored or Warped Trim
Discolored or warped trim can show hidden moisture and potential structural damage. Our team can identify the source of the issue and fix it before it becomes a bigger problem.
High Humidity Levels
High humidity levels in your home can show hidden moisture and potential mold growth. Our team can identify the source of the issue and fix it before it leads to further damage.

Window Leak Water Removal Cost in Riverdale, UT
The cost of window leak water removal in Riverdale, UT var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ates are based on industry standards, but the final cost will depend on an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ates and flexible pricing options to ensure you get the help you need without breaking the bank.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Containment |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of damage and size of affected area. |
| Water Extraction and Drying | $1,000 – $4,000 | Size of affected area and type of equipment used. |
| Cleaning and Disinfecting |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of damage and type of surfaces affected. |
| Remediation and Repair | $2,000 – $6,000 | Severity of damage and complexity of repair. |
| Moisture Control and Prevention |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of damage and type of moisture control measures needed. |

Common Questions About Window Leak Water Removal
Q: What causes water damage from window leaks?
A: Water damage from window leaks is usually caused by a combination of factors, including poor window installation, worn-out seals, and weather-related events. Our team can identify the source of the issue and fix it before it leads to further damage.
Q: How long does it take to fix water damage from window leaks?
A: The time it takes to fix water damage from window leaks depends on the severity of the damage and the complexity of the repair. Our team can provide a customized timeline for your specific situation.
Q: Can I DIY window leak water removal?
A: While some minor issues can be fixed with DIY projects, major water damage from window leaks needs specialized equipment and expertise to ensure the job is done right and prevent future problems. Our team has the expertise and equipment to fix the issue quickly and prevent further damage.
Q: Will my insurance cover window leak water removal?
A: Insurance coverage for window leak water removal varies depending on your policy and the circumstances of the damage. Our team can help you file a claim and navigate the insurance process.
Q: How can I prevent water damage from window leaks?
A: To prevent water damage from window leaks, make sure to inspect your windows regularly, check for worn-out seals, and maintain your home’s exterior to prevent water from entering the window frame. Our team can provide customized recommendations for your specific situation.
